This clinical metric quantifies the equilibrium and functional efficacy of androgenic hormones, such as testosterone and dihydrotestosterone, within an individual’s physiological system. It reflects more than just circulating levels, incorporating the bioavailability and receptor sensitivity across target tissues like muscle, bone, and brain. Achieving an optimal status is crucial for maintaining lean body mass, bone mineral density, cognitive function, and overall metabolic health. The status represents a dynamic target, moving beyond simple reference ranges to align hormonal signaling with peak systemic function and wellness goals.
Origin
The concept of “Androgen Optimization Status” emerges from the field of endocrinology, evolving from basic hormone replacement therapy to a more personalized, functional approach. Its etymological roots lie in the Greek words andro (man) and genes (producing), referring to male-characteristic-producing steroids. The shift from measuring deficiency to assessing optimization is a modern clinical paradigm focused on achieving ideal health outcomes rather than merely preventing pathology. This advanced terminology is fundamental to contemporary hormonal health and longevity protocols.
Mechanism
Androgen optimization operates primarily through genomic and non-genomic pathways, influencing gene expression in androgen-responsive cells. The optimization process involves balancing the hypothalamic-pituitary-gonadal axis feedback loop and managing the conversion of testosterone to its potent metabolite, dihydrotestosterone, via 5-alpha reductase. Furthermore, appropriate management of sex hormone-binding globulin is essential to ensure adequate free androgens are available for binding to intracellular receptors, thereby modulating protein synthesis, erythropoiesis, and central nervous system activity.
